Keeping Your Health & Wellbeing in Check

Amidst the COVID-19 pandemic, it is more important than ever to take care of your health and wellbeing. Not only does this virus affect our physical health, but there are sure to be worries surrounding finances, health anxiety and even diminished mental health due to self-isolation (as great as it sounds at first, being stuck at home for 24 hours a day isn’t all it’s cracked up to be). However, these are all things we can take control of to reduce our worries and ultimately stay healthy inside and out.


It’s really common to feel a sense of overwhelm or anxiety at the current situation. You are not alone. We are all in this together and will hopefully be protected by the government, who are announcing new updates by the day. It’s easy to say ‘do not panic’ but if we all stick together to try and stay calm and act responsibly, we should be able to get through this (with plenty of loo roll to go around).


Firstly, eat well. Despite the supermarkets being stretched to capacity and many shelves quickly emptying, there still seems to be stocks of fresh food available which is ideally what we want to be filling ourselves with. Fruit, vegetables, fish. It’s this fresh and wholesome food that will keep your insides healthy, packing you with the antioxidants and vitamins needed to boost your immune system. Exercise is a fantastic way to relieve stress, whether it’s going for a run (at a distance from others, of course) or making up your own 15-minute home workout. It’s proven to release chemicals in the brain that can act as an anti-anxiety remedy and is a well-known way to use up that extra adrenaline you build up from stress. Similarly, meditation can really help you to relax. Put on a YouTube video and spend 10 minutes doing some breathing exercises – we guarantee you will come out the other side calmer and lighter.


Creating a calm space at home is really important, especially for those who are working remotely and need to concentrate. We’re going to be spending a lot of time there over the coming weeks, and if you’re working you want to be able to focus. Make sure you stick to some sort of routine, get showered and dressed before setting up a comfy spot to work, free from distractions (does not apply if you have pets or children unfortunately...)   


Check in with friends and family – it can be easy to feel isolated and lonely during these times but the magic of a phone call or a message can go a long way. Stay connected! Technology is a wonderful thing…


Lastly, don’t fret about financial burdens. The government has been bringing out some fantastic announcements to help businesses and employees which will really help us through. If you are at all worried, just give your bank a call and talk through the options – it will be sure to put your mind at ease.


We are all in the same boat and the way communities have pulled together is nothing short of amazing. Let’s all do what we can to get through this with a positive mind, use the time to learn something new and connect with loved ones (albeit through a screen).
